I don't know which sites do things from the Netherlands, but I book travel online frequently in the states. There are a couple of things that you can consider...

1. Don't be tied down to one city. There are three airports I can fly out of easily (my home airport and two others an hour away). There are two other major airports that are about three hours away. I've seen dramatic differences in fares between them -- I'll drive an hour to save $400 bucks. You have to play around a bit and know what your acceptible tolerance is.

2. Be flexible in your times and dates. There can be great variations in just a day or so.

3. Consider your alternatives. If you've got to be back Monday morning, it's not a good idea to grab the last plane Sunday night. If something goes wrong, you're toast.

4. Remember the first rule of travel: always get closer to your final destination. If you have a choice between taking a flight now that connects somewhere and lets you sit for three hours in that airport, take it. It's better than waiting in this airport for three hours to catch your original flight.

5. Smile. No matter what happens when travelling, it will soon be over. Get used to it, and move on. You'll be happier, and so will everyone else.
